Aloo Fry

This vibrant and flavorful dish features crispy and perfectly seasoned potato bites that are sure to tantalize your taste buds. The aromatic spices and golden hue of this dish promise a satisfying and irresistible culinary experience.

Aloo Fry
Prep time
10 min
Cook time
20 min
Yield
4 servings
Difficulty
MEDIUM

Ingredients

Quantities are shown as originally provided.

  • 500 g Potatoes (peeled and diced)
  • 3 tbsp Vegetable Oil
  • 1 tsp Cumin Seeds
  • 1 tsp Mustard Seeds
  • 1 Onion
  • 2 Green Chillies (finely chopped)
  • 1 tsp Turmeric Powder
  • 1 tsp Chilli Powder
  • 1 tsp Coriander Powder
  • Salt
  • Coriander (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. 1

    Heat vegetable oil in a large frying pan over medium heat.

  2. 2

    Add cumin seeds and mustard seeds. Allow them to splutter.

  3. 3

    Add chopped onions and green chillies. Sauté until onions turn translucent.

  4. 4

    Add diced potatoes to the pan. C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.

  5. 5

    Sprinkle turmeric powder, chilli powder, coriander powder, and salt over the potatoes. Mix well to coat evenly.

  6. 6

    Cover and cook for 10-15 minutes, or until potatoes are tender, stirring occasionally.

  7. 7

    Once the potatoes are cooked through and golden brown, remove from heat.

  8. 8

    Garnish with fresh coriander leaves.

  9. 9

    Serve hot as a side dish with rice or roti.
